It’s morning, and time for session two! A bubbly Norelle hops in with a smile so bright. It’s clear she has braces, but Noelle says she has “bling bling on her grill.” Oh dear. She’s led a real life Cinderella story. She never met her real mom until she was 13, and always used to play model at home. This one seems a little ditsy, but I like her.

In comes Kelly and she’s very gorgeous – she looks like Trenyce from American Idol 2. Her friends used to call her a white girl with a good tan since she grew up around mostly white girls. Mrs. J doesn’t seem impressed, and after we see some girls doing some horrible walks, Mrs. J says people think he’s a miracle worker but not even he can fix some of these walks.

Mary walks in next and asks “what’s up” with there being no big girls. She really wants to advance with the other big girl, Toccara, to see what happens. Toccara walks in next and the judges love her sass. She says she loves her skin and starts to work it. She wants to encourage all full figured girls to try modeling and adds that skinny girls are the devil – but she’s just playing. When she slips into her bikini (That’s right, a BIKINI), Mrs. J’s eyes light up like light bulbs when he sees her ta-tas. When she leaves, he tells Tyra and Jay that those things are not puppies, they are full grown dogs!

Next, we meet Amy. She’s 5’11 and 115 lbs. This girl looks DANGEROUSLY thin. She says she hates when people think she’s anorexic. She feels great and is working on gaining weight since she’s so skinny. Tyra feels that she is too thin right now, and might send a bad image for women. Amy appreciates the constructive criticism.

In comes that girl carrying “Baby” saying that he wanted to meet Tyra. Wacko. Some girl says she wants to be a model – or a dancer. Some girl has spunk but no boobs. Mrs. J is the funniest because he doesn’t care about half of them. Some girl, in the middle of her audition, decides she doesn’t want to do it anymore and just walks out and says she’s going home! Tyra and the other judges do nothing but crack up. I think I would too!

Next up is Leah, and she’s 24 from Oklahoma. She admits that she’s very excited to be there, and comes from a big Catholic family. When asked if she would oppose posing nude, her reply is, “Nude me up!”

Amanda says she has wanted to model since she was three. She’s a mom kind of girl and Jay says that she’ll be whisked away for a little and won’t get to see her son much. Amanda knows that, but she knows she has to do it for her son. When asked, she says her best feature is her eyes, and then tells the camera that she has a problem with them as well. After she leaves, all the judges comment on how much they love her eyes as well.

At dinner that evening, Eva talks with a few other girls about something being wrong with Amy. She doesn’t believe Amy when she says she’s naturally thin, and looking at her bones makes her gag. Ann says that Amy should be in the hospital for the way she looks. Mary comments that Eva is a bitch, while Eva continues to make fun of Amy. Okay, I officially don’t like Eva, and the first episode isn’t even over. Amy says that the whole thing is just a competition and she lets things roll right off her back and simply hopes that the right girls get cut. On that, it’s time for the third session!

Yaya is up first and this girl is beautiful. She attends Brown University and speaks several languages. Her father is a priest and she feel she is representing the statement “beauty is black” – which is much better than just feeling you have to represent a whole race. Her only physical flaw that she feels she has is her breakouts sometimes. Tyra is very impressed with Yaya, and Mr. J also thinks she is pretty, but isn’t totally sold on her yet.

Jennipher is 22 and from Pocatello Falls, Idaho. She says that Pocatello is not somewhere she wants to be for the rest of her life. This is her chance to get out and she needs Tyra’s help. Listen, Jenn – Tyra’s not a social worker – get out on your own time!

In comes Rachael. She’s from Alabama and recently moved to New York and has done some modeling in the past. Mrs. J loves her look right away.

Kristi is 20 and feels her best asset is her blonde hair. She says she’s a Republican and shows them the dress she wore to the prom – which is designed like the American flag. Amazing flag, but tacky as a dress. Mrs. J says he would have work a sparkling red shoe.

The next girl, Nargis, says she tried out last year and was cut as a semi-finalist. She’s happy to have a second chance. Nargis tells the judges she sees being a model only as a job. She knows she gets nervous and loses her train of though, and as she leaves, the judges all comment they love her body, but aren’t sure about her.
